Why Choose Vitamin C with Rose Hips and Bioflavonoids?

Vitamin C, or ascorbic acid, is an essential water-soluble vitamin that the human body cannot produce. It plays a crucial role in maintaining normal collagen formation for healthy skin, blood vessels, bones, and cartilage. Additionally, it contributes to the normal function of the immune system and acts as an antioxidant to protect cells from oxidative stress. Types of Vitamin C Supplements

Vitamin C supplements come in several forms, each with distinct advantages. The most common is ascorbic acid, which is well-absorbed and cost-effective. Buffered forms like sodium ascorbate are gentler on the stomach, while liposomal vitamin C is designed for enhanced absorption. Whole-food sources such as acerola and camu camu offer a natural profile of co-nutrients. Nature's Truth uses ascorbic acid as the primary source, combined with a Citrus Bioflavonoid Complex and Wild Rose Hips. Bioflavonoids are plant compounds that may improve the absorption of vitamin C and provide their own antioxidant benefits. Rose hips, the fruit of the rose plant, are naturally rich in vitamin C and offer additional phytonutrients.

Recommended Dosage and Safety

The recommended serving for Nature's Truth Vitamin C with Rose Hips and Bioflavonoids is one (1) caplet daily, preferably with a meal. Each caplet provides 500 mg of vitamin C, which is 556% of the Daily Value. The tolerable upper intake level for adults is 2,000 mg per day, so this supplement fits well within safe limits for most individuals. Vitamin C is generally well tolerated, but taking more than 2,000 mg daily may cause digestive discomfort or diarrhoea. If you are pregnant, nursing, or have a medical condition, consult your health care provider before uses. Always read the label and follow directions for uses.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I take vitamin C on an empty stomach?

For most people, vitamin C is gentle on the stomach, but taking it with food may help reduce the risk of minor digestive upset. The bioflavonoids and rose hips in this formula may also contribute to a more gentle experience.

Is it safe to take 500 mg of vitamin C daily?

Yes, 500 mg daily is a common and safe dosage for adults. The recommended dietary allowance (RDA) for vitamin C is 90 mg for men and 75 mg for women, but higher doses are often taken for additional antioxidant and immune support.

What is the difference between ascorbic acid and rose hips?

Ascorbic acid is the synthetic form of vitamin C, while rose hips are a natural source that contains vitamin C along with other beneficial compounds like flavonoids. This supplement combines both for a comprehensive approach.
